Chris Janssen, a results coach and author of "Grace Yourself," specializes in guiding perfectionists through self-sabotage. In this discussion, he unravels the hidden struggles of high achievers, addressing how societal pressures impact self-worth. Janssen shares transformative coaching tools and personal anecdotes about sobriety and recovery from perfectionism. He emphasizes the power of community, the significance of self-acceptance, and practical strategies for fostering emotional well-being, urging listeners to challenge negative beliefs and embrace growth.

Perfectionism vs. High Achievement
- High achievers differ from perfectionists because achievers adapt tactics to reach goals, while perfectionists may abandon goals if perfection fails.
- Recognizing this can help people persist by prioritizing outcomes over perfect processes.
Chris Janssen's Sobriety Journey
- Chris Janssen shares how her recovery journey from alcoholism began at 37 after struggling for years with moderation.
- Her honesty about shame and eventual acceptance highlights the complex path to sobriety.
Tipping Point At 3 AM
- Chris describes her tipping point where alcohol shame dissolved at a first AA meeting at 3 a.m.
- She realized she was deserving of recovery, sparking a lifelong sobriety journey.
